Event Overview

The Montana Women's Run is a running event scheduled for Saturday, May 9, 2026. It will be held in downtown Billings, Montana, on 2nd Avenue North between North 25th Street and North 24th Street.

Key Information

This is described as the 45th annual running of the event. Participants can walk, run, or use a wheelchair for either the 2 Mile or 5 Mile distance. Children in strollers do not require registration unless a t-shirt is desired.

All participants must pre-register. Registration deadlines and procedures vary:

  • The registration price for in-person events increases after April 20, 2026.
  • Online registration for in-person events closes at 12:00 p.m. on Friday, May 8, 2026.
  • There is no race day registration for new participants.
  • Packet and t-shirt pickup for in-person events is mandatory on Thursday, May 7, or Friday, May 8, from 9:00 a.m. to 6:00 p.m. each day at a race headquarters to be determined.
  • Pre-registered out-of-town participants may pick up packets on race day from 7:00 a.m. to 8:30 a.m.
  • Registration for the virtual events closes on April 20, 2026. Virtual participants will have their t-shirts and packets mailed to them.

An optional short-sleeve tech shirt is available for an extra fee, with limited supply. Participants will also receive a link to a virtual race bag.

A free Kid's Run for children aged 10 and under will be held separately on Tuesday, May 5, 2026, at 6:00 p.m. at Rocky Mountain College.

Course Rules

Bikes, rollerblades, skateboards, pets, smoking, and headphones are not permitted on the course. Visit the organization's website for the most recent information.
